Stranger Things Demogorgon Necklace
Relive the thrill and the terror of the Demogorgon with this Stranger Things Demogorgon Necklace. It basically looks like a starfish from Satan’s beach resort. *Shudders* And that’s just the demo-Gorgon! They really cranked it up to Eleven on this one. Get it? I knew you would. That’s why you and me were meant to be together. You get me. You really get me. Now get me a coke and some fries k? Love you too. Kisses.